1. Understanding Water Hyacinth as a Material

Water Hyacinth Basket durability and aesthetic appeal come from the unique properties of its raw material. Water hyacinth is a fast-growing aquatic plant found in rivers and lakes across Southeast Asia, particularly in Vietnam and Thailand — two leading export regions for handmade baskets.

1.1 Natural Structure and Texture

The plant’s stems are buoyant, flexible, and filled with air pockets, which make them lightweight yet sturdy when dried and woven. The finished weave has a soft, smooth texture and an earthy tone, giving it a premium handmade appearance.

However, unlike synthetic materials, water hyacinth fibers are highly absorbent. When exposed to water, they tend to swell slightly, softening the weave structure. That’s why improper washing can cause distortion, fading, or even breakage if not handled correctly.

2. What Actually Happens When You Wash a Water Hyacinth Basket

Water Hyacinth Basket reacts quite differently to washing than synthetic or seagrass baskets. Because it’s made of untreated plant fiber, direct exposure to water affects both the basket’s structure and longevity.

2.1 Fiber Swelling and Softening

When you soak or wash a basket under running water, the fibers absorb moisture quickly. The weave temporarily loosens, and depending on drying conditions, it might never return to its original tightness. This swelling can cause uneven shapes, especially in large baskets used for laundry or décor display.

2.2 Color and Finish Alteration

Many water hyacinth baskets are lightly coated with clear lacquer or water-based finish to enhance durability. Excessive washing can strip this coating, making the basket look dull or discolored. If the piece has a dyed or stained finish, pigments may fade unevenly, leading to patchy color tones.

2.3 Mold and Odor Formation

If not dried completely, moisture trapped within the weave becomes an ideal environment for mold and mildew. This not only affects the appearance but also creates unpleasant odors — a serious issue for retailers shipping internationally, especially to humid markets like Singapore or Dubai.

2.4 Structural Weakening

Repeated washing weakens fiber tension. Handles or rims may loosen, and the bottom might warp under weight. This deterioration is gradual but inevitable if cleaning isn’t done with care.

3. Safe Cleaning and Maintenance Techniques

Water Hyacinth Basket cleaning should focus on dry or minimal-moisture methods to avoid damage. Retailers and wholesalers can use these guidelines when preparing product manuals or after-sale care leaflets.

3.1 Dry Brushing and Vacuuming

Use a soft-bristled brush or vacuum with a brush attachment to remove dust and debris. This method preserves the natural color and texture while preventing dirt buildup. For retailers, it’s an easy cleaning recommendation that adds professionalism to product packaging.

3.2 Spot Cleaning With Damp Cloth

When small stains occur, gently wipe with a damp (not wet) cloth. Mix mild soap with warm water, wring out excess liquid, and clean only the affected area. Immediately dry with a soft towel to prevent absorption.

3.3 Sunlight and Air Drying

If the basket accidentally gets wet, place it under indirect sunlight or in a ventilated area. Avoid direct heat sources — they can cause cracking. Natural air drying ensures even moisture evaporation and helps retain shape. Vietnamese exporters often test drying techniques under tropical conditions to simulate customer environments.

3.4 Natural Deodorizing

To eliminate odor, place a sachet of activated charcoal or baking soda inside for 24 hours. This neutralizes smells without damaging fibers. Wholesalers can include small care cards recommending this as an eco-friendly deodorizing solution — a great marketing touch for sustainable buyers.

4. How Washing Impacts Export Quality and Retail Value

Water Hyacinth Basket quality control doesn’t end at the factory. Retailers and importers must understand that post-purchase washing habits significantly influence brand reputation and warranty issues.

4.1 For Exporters and Manufacturers

In Vietnam, skilled artisans treat water hyacinth baskets with heat or smoke drying to reduce moisture content before export. However, when foreign customers wash the baskets, that internal moisture balance gets disturbed, causing fiber expansion and contraction. This is why most exporters recommend only surface cleaning and provide moisture-resistant coatings for specific orders.

5. Alternative Cleaning Methods for Long-Term Preservation

Water Hyacinth Basket care doesn’t need to rely on washing. Instead, adopting sustainable and minimal-intervention maintenance routines keeps the piece looking elegant for years.

5.1 Using Natural Cleaners

Spray a mist of diluted white vinegar or essential oils to refresh and disinfect surfaces. Wipe with a dry cloth immediately afterward. These natural solutions prevent bacteria growth without introducing excess moisture.

5.2 Preventive Storage

When not in use, keep baskets in dry, shaded spaces. Avoid sealed plastic bags — they trap humidity. Instead, breathable cotton covers maintain airflow while preventing dust buildup.

5.3 Restoration for Aged Baskets

If an older water hyacinth basket becomes brittle, lightly apply coconut or linseed oil to the surface using a soft cloth. This rehydrates the fibers, restoring flexibility and sheen. Many Vietnamese artisans also use this method during product finishing for export-quality shine.
